SMLJ17CA Equivalent & Substitute Parts
Part Overview
The SMLJ17CA is a bidirectional transient voltage suppressor (TVS) diode manufactured by Bourns Inc., designed for general-purpose overvoltage protection in surface-mount applications. This component features a 17V reverse standoff voltage, 27.6V maximum clamping voltage, and 3000W peak pulse power rating in a DO-214AB (SMC) package. The part is active in production, RoHS3 compliant, and carries unlimited moisture sensitivity level (MSL 1).
Equivalent and substitute parts are identified when they maintain critical electrical parameters—specifically reverse standoff voltage, clamping voltage, and peak pulse current—while accommodating variations in peak pulse power and operating temperature ranges based on application requirements.

Substitute Part Grouping Explanation
Substitute parts for the SMLJ17CA are classified into two categories based on electrical parameter compatibility:
Direct Equivalents maintain all critical electrical parameters within specification: 17V reverse standoff voltage, 18.9V minimum breakdown voltage, 27.6V maximum clamping voltage, and surface-mount DO-214AB packaging. These parts are interchangeable in applications where the 3000W peak pulse power rating and specified operating temperature range are acceptable.
Similar Substitutes maintain the core voltage parameters (17V standoff, 27.6V clamping) but differ in peak pulse current capacity and/or peak pulse power rating. These parts are suitable for applications where higher power dissipation capability (5000W) or lower current handling (1500W) is acceptable, provided the voltage protection thresholds remain within the required specification window.
Key Parameters for Substitution Determination:
- Voltage - Reverse Standoff: 17V (fixed requirement)
- Voltage - Clamping (Max) @ Ipp: 27.6V (fixed requirement)
- Package / Case: DO-214AB, SMC (fixed requirement)
- Mounting Type: Surface Mount (fixed requirement)
- Peak Pulse Current: 54.4A to 181A (variable, application-dependent)
- Peak Pulse Power: 1500W to 5000W (variable, application-dependent)
- Operating Temperature: -55°C to 175°C (variable, application-dependent)

Engineering Selection Recommendations
Direct Equivalent Selection: SMDJ17CA (Alpha & Omega Semiconductor Inc.) is the primary direct equivalent, matching all critical electrical parameters and operating temperature range. This part maintains 17V standoff voltage, 27.6V clamping voltage, and 3000W peak pulse power with marginally higher peak pulse current (108.7A vs. 106.6A). Both parts are RoHS3 compliant and carry EAR99 ECCN classification.
Higher Power Capability Selection: 5.0SMDJ17CA (MDE Semiconductor Inc.) and 5.0SMDJ17CA-T7 (Littelfuse Inc.) provide 5000W peak pulse power rating with 181A peak pulse current, suitable for applications requiring enhanced transient energy absorption. The Littelfuse variant extends the lower operating temperature limit to -65°C. Both maintain the 17V standoff and 27.6V clamping specifications. Selection between these two depends on extended low-temperature operation requirements.
Lower Power Capability Selection: SMCJ17CA-TP (Micro Commercial Co) provides 1500W peak pulse power with 54.4A peak pulse current, suitable for lower-energy transient environments. This part extends the upper operating temperature to 175°C and is appropriate for applications with reduced overvoltage energy levels.
Voltage Parameter Deviation: SM30T21CAY (STMicroelectronics) deviates from the core voltage specification with 18V standoff voltage, 20V breakdown voltage, and 29.2V clamping voltage. This part is suitable only when the application circuit can tolerate higher clamping voltage and later trigger threshold. The part carries AEC-Q101 automotive qualification and extends operating temperature to 175°C.
Incomplete Data Parts: SMCJ17CA and SMCJ17CA (Fairchild Semiconductor) lack sufficient electrical parameter documentation for engineering selection and should not be used as substitutes without complete datasheet verification.
Frequently Asked Questions (FAQ)
Q: Can SMDJ17CA directly replace SMLJ17CA without circuit modification? A: Yes. SMDJ17CA maintains identical standoff voltage (17V), clamping voltage (27.6V), and power rating (3000W) with equivalent peak pulse current (108.7A vs. 106.6A). Both use DO-214AB packaging and operate across -55°C to 150°C. No circuit modification is required.
Q: When should 5.0SMDJ17CA be selected over SMLJ17CA? A: Select 5.0SMDJ17CA when the application experiences transient energy levels exceeding 3000W or when peak pulse current requirements exceed 106.6A. The 5000W rating provides additional margin for high-energy transient events while maintaining identical voltage protection thresholds.
Q: Is SM30T21CAY compatible with SMLJ17CA? A: SM30T21CAY is not a direct equivalent. It specifies 18V standoff voltage and 29.2V clamping voltage, which exceed SMLJ17CA specifications by 1V and 1.6V respectively. Use only when the protected circuit can tolerate delayed trigger threshold and higher clamping voltage. Verify circuit tolerance before substitution.
Q: What is the difference between SMCJ17CA-TP and SMLJ17CA? A: SMCJ17CA-TP maintains identical voltage parameters (17V standoff, 27.6V clamping) but provides only 1500W peak pulse power versus 3000W. Select SMCJ17CA-TP only for low-energy transient environments or when peak pulse current does not exceed 54.4A. The part extends operating temperature to 175°C.
Q: Are there packaging differences between substitute parts? A: All listed substitutes use DO-214AB (SMC) surface-mount packaging. Packaging compatibility is maintained across all direct and similar equivalents. Verify tape & reel (TR) or bulk packaging availability based on procurement requirements.
Q: What compliance certifications apply to these substitutes? A: All parts listed are RoHS3 compliant. SM30T21CAY carries additional AEC-Q101 automotive qualification. REACH status varies: SMLJ17CA is REACH Affected; SMDJ17CA, 5.0SMDJ17CA, 5.0SMDJ17CA-T7, SM30T21CAY, and SMCJ17CA-TP are REACH Unaffected. Verify compliance requirements for your application before final selection.
Q: Can SMCJ17CA or SMCJ17CA (Fairchild) be used as substitutes? A: These parts lack complete electrical parameter documentation in available data. Do not use as substitutes without obtaining and verifying complete datasheets against SMLJ17CA specifications.
